A Californian appeals courtroom dominated that lawsuits from two males who allege that Michael Jackson molested them as kids are free to pursue litigation in opposition to firms owned by the singer, who died in 2009.
40-year-old Wade Robson and 45-year-old James Safechuck have alleged that Michael Jackson sexually abused them for years and that workers of his two firms, MJJ Productions Inc. and MJJ Ventures Inc., had been complicit and acted as his “co-conspirators, collaborators, facilitators, and alter egos.” The lawsuits declare that workers of the businesses did not take steps to stop abuse, violating their “responsibility of care” owed to the boys.
The 2 firms at the moment are owned by Michael Jackson’s property, which has repeatedly denied any abuse of Robson or Safechuck.
“We stay absolutely assured that Michael is harmless of those allegations, that are opposite to all credible proof and impartial corroboration, and which had been solely first made years after Michael’s dying by males motivated solely by cash,” mentioned Jonathan Steinsapir, an lawyer for the Jackson property.
The HBO documentary “Leaving Neverland” featured each males’s tales, wherein Robson and Safechuck accused Michael Jackson of molesting them and cultivating relationships with their households to safe entry to the boys.
“All people needed to fulfill Michael or be with Michael,” mentioned Safechuck within the movie. “He was already bigger than life. After which he likes you.”
An lawyer for Safechuck and Robson, Vince Finaldi, mentioned that the courtroom had overturned “incorrect rulings in these instances which had been in opposition to California legislation and would have set a harmful precedent that endangered kids.”
Robson and Safechuck filed their lawsuits in opposition to the Jackson firms in 2013 and 2014, respectively. In 2017, each instances had been dismissed attributable to exceeding California’s statute of limitations. In 2020, each instances had been reopened after a brand new state legislation offered plaintiffs in baby intercourse abuse instances a further grace interval to file lawsuits.
The fits had been once more dismissed in October 2020 and April 2021, when a Los Angeles County Superior Courtroom decide dominated that the 2 firms and their workers weren’t legally obligated to guard Safechuck and Robson.
Nonetheless, on Friday, August 18, California’s Second District Courtroom of Appeals dominated {that a} “company that facilitates the sexual abuse of youngsters by one in every of its workers is just not excused from an affirmative responsibility to guard these kids merely as a result of it’s solely owned by the perpetrator of the abuse.”
The instances had been consolidated within the appeals courtroom and can now return to a trial courtroom. Earlier than the Robson and Safechuck lawsuits, Michael Jackson confronted two separate prison investigations in 1994 and 2003 into the attainable sexual abuse of youngsters.
